Polar Bear: Climate Action Now For Everyone's Sake

Cop 21, Le Bourget, Paris

09 December, 2015

Greenpeace staged an action this afternoon at the UN climate talks in Paris to stress the need to involve indigenous people in climate talks so as to reach a deal that is sustainable for humanity.

In the midst was Chief Bill Erastus who said "We are not in these talks. We aren't in the room. Why? Yet we protect the land and the water."

From the arctic to the pacific south, COP 21 must protect everyone; people and animals.
